Description
In the seaside village of Watchcombe, young Kate is determined to make the most of her last week of summer holiday.
But when she discovers a mysterious painting entitled 'The Lord of Winter' in a charity shop, it leads her on an adventure she never could have planned. Kate soon realises the old seascape, painted long ago by an eccentric local artist, is actually a puzzle. And with the help of some bizarre new acquaintances - including a museum curator's magical cat, a miserable neighbour, and a lonely boy - she plans on solving it. And then, one morning, Kate wakes up to a world changed forever.
For the Lord of Winter is coming - and Kate has a very important decision to make. Inspired by the Doctor Who episode The Bells of Saint John, this charming story is read by Clare Corbett. 2 CDs. 1 hr 57 mins.
